The Restoration Road with Mitch Kruse
Mitch Kruse
377 episodes
8 months ago
Just like a classic car in need of restoration, each one of us must surrender the old, the pieces, and the new in order to be restored to authenticity, reflecting the design of the Designer. Dr. Mitch Kruse engages those with stories of restoration in Christ to share their journeys from tragedy to triumph.
